Output 118cdc86ccb7731c53ae1306c60163a70cecc2eb0fd276d7df6ee54ddd20ffa4:0

value
1096887943
script pubkey
OP_0 OP_PUSHBYTES_20 a6f8cda6ddada4de36bdc838ef1e5d9d217d1310
address
tb1q5muvmfka4kjdud4aequw78jan5sh6ycs9z748f
transaction
118cdc86ccb7731c53ae1306c60163a70cecc2eb0fd276d7df6ee54ddd20ffa4
confirmations
102917
spent
true